Executive Chairperson of Bangalore-based global biopharmaceutical company Biocon Ltd, Kiran Mazundar-Shaw, has been appointed to the Board of Trustees of the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center New York. MSK has one of the most dynamic cancer research programs, globally, operating over 120 laboratories and work toward understanding each and every type of disease better.
Mazumdar-Shaw is the first woman of Indian nationality to be appointed for this role. She is among the 52 members on the board and will serve for a term of three years w.e.f. April 14, 2021.
